It was steady as she goes on the jobs front last month. Statistics Canada released the lastest unemployment rate, which remained unchanged at 7.1% in June. The economy shed 400 jobs last month, a statistically insignificant number. It was good news in London though, where 600 new jobs were created last month, dropping the unemployment rate from 9.8% to 9.2% In May, when 95,000 new jobs were added in Canada, the largest month of job growth since the recession in 2008.
